It’s interesting what works in a comic book setting and what doesn’t. I’m always interested in why characters who were originally throwaways like the Joker. Where characters like Bane, who were specifically designed to be a nemesis for Batman, just muddle along.

While I didn’t care for him that much in Knightfall, I certainly thought he deserved better than mostly being treated as just a thug on steroids that he’s been used as most of the time since Knightfall.

Recently he’s been treated much better in such titles as Gail Simone’s Secret Six and Tom King’s Batman storyline “I Am Bane”. Currently, my favorite version is his cameo in Young Justice where he is first voiced by the great Danny Trejo.
